And Now, Extreme Dancing

Documentary of the Week | Nov 13, 2015

The documentary "OXD: One Extraordinary Day" brings us choreographer Elizabeth Streb and her dance troupe Extreme Action Company as they rehearse in Brooklyn and perform in London, dangling from the London Eye and the Millenium Bridge. This fun, exhilarating and emotional film makes its world premier at the DOC NYC festival on Saturday.
